Přeskočit na hlavní obsah

MCP Server

MCP (Model Context Protocol) server umožňuje propojit MujVykaz s AI nástroji — Claude Desktop, VS Code, Claude CLI a dalšími.

Instalace

Není potřeba nic instalovat globálně. Server se spouští přes npx:

npx -y mujvykaz-mcp

Konfigurace

Nastavte proměnnou prostředí s vaším API klíčem:

export MUJVYKAZ_API_KEY="vas_api_klic"

Claude Desktop

Přidejte do konfigurace (~/.claude/config.json nebo Claude Desktop settings):

{
"mcpServers": {
"mujvykaz": {
"command": "npx",
"args": ["-y", "mujvykaz-mcp"],
"env": {
"MUJVYKAZ_API_KEY": "vas_api_klic"
}
}
}
}

VS Code

Přidejte do .vscode/mcp.json nebo uživatelských nastavení:

{
"servers": {
"mujvykaz": {
"command": "npx",
"args": ["-y", "mujvykaz-mcp"],
"env": {
"MUJVYKAZ_API_KEY": "vas_api_klic"
}
}
}
}

Dostupné nástroje (18)

Profil a statistiky

NástrojPopis
my_profileZobrazí profil přihlášeného uživatele
my_statsOsobní statistiky (hodiny, projekty)
team_statsStatistiky celého týmu

Záznamy práce

NástrojPopis
list_time_entriesSeznam záznamů s filtry
create_time_entryNový záznam práce
update_time_entryÚprava záznamu
delete_time_entrySmazání záznamu
submit_time_entriesOdeslání ke schválení
approve_time_entriesSchválení záznamů

Projekty a klienti

NástrojPopis
list_projectsSeznam projektů
create_projectNový projekt
update_projectÚprava projektu
list_clientsSeznam klientů
create_clientNový klient
update_clientÚprava klienta

Faktury a reporty

NástrojPopis
list_invoicesSeznam faktur
list_usersSeznam členů týmu
query_reportsAI dotaz na data (text → SQL → výsledek)

Příklady použití

V Claude Desktop nebo CLI můžete psát přirozeně:

  • „Kolik hodin jsem odpracoval tento týden?"
  • „Založ nový projekt Web redesign pro klienta Firma s.r.o."
  • „Zapiš 3 hodiny na projekt API integrace za dnešek."
  • „Kdo z týmu odpracoval nejvíc hodin za březen?"
  • „Odešli moje výkazy za tento týden ke schválení."

Přístupová práva

MCP server respektuje roli API klíče. Worker může spravovat jen svá data, manager vidí přiřazené klienty, admin vše.

tip

MCP server je ideální pro rychlé zadávání výkazů přímo z editoru nebo terminálu — bez přepínání do prohlížeče.